java-数组

  • 定义数组
double[] myList; // 首选的方法 
 double myList[]; // 效果相同,但不是首选方法
  • 创建一维数组
int[] a = {1,2,3,4}
int[] b = new int[4]
int [] c = new  int[rand.nextInt(4)]
  • 二维数组
String str[][] = new String[3][4];
  • 二维数组分配值
# 两行三列
String s[][] = new String[2][];
s[0] = new String[2];
s[1] = new String[3];
s[0][0] = new String("Good");
s[0][1] = new String("Luck");
s[1][0] = new String("to");
s[1][1] = new String("you");
s[1][2] = new String("!");



float[][] numthree;             //定义一个float类型的2维数组
numthree=new float[5][5];       //为它分配5行5列的空间大小
  • 打印数组
public class TestArray {
   public static void main(String[] args) {
      double[] myList = {1.9, 2.9, 3.4, 3.5};
 
      // 打印所有数组元素
      for (double element: myList) {
         System.out.println(element);
      }
   }
}
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 数组类型和数组引用变量详解 数组类型为什么要用数组?Java数组的两大特征:定义数组时,不能指定数组的长度变量分为...
    Ansaxnsy阅读 7,934评论 2 3
  • 在Java中,数组的工作方式和C/C++不同 一维数组 一维数组本质上是一连串类型相同的变量。为创建数组,首先必须...
    多了去的YangXuLei阅读 3,800评论 0 1
  • 05.01_Java语言基础(数组概述和定义格式说明)(了解) A:为什么要有数组(容器)为了存储同种数据类型的多...
    苦笑男神阅读 3,770评论 0 0
  • 今天我来给你解释寻租的概念,话说发明寻租这个概念的经济学家叫做戈登·图洛克 ,Gordon Tullock 它是薛...
    孤独中的喧嚣阅读 3,945评论 0 0
  • 刚开始看到《再见阿郎》的时候还以为是周润发主演的,原来和发哥的《阿郎的故事》搞混了,两部影片都是杜琪峰导演的,一个...
    电影聚焦阅读 5,385评论 0 2

友情链接更多精彩内容